## 引言 在数字货币迅速发展的今日,比特币作为领头羊,其核心钱包无疑是用户进行比特币存储和交易的重要工具。随着时间的推移,比特币核心钱包不断迭代更新,特别是在数据库的结构和功能上进行了多项神级更新,使得其在管理比特币资产时的性能和安全性得到显著提升。本文将深度探讨比特币核心钱包的数据库架构、数据存储和管理方法,同时也将解答一些与之相关的常见问题,帮助用户更好地了解和使用这一强大的工具。 ## 一、比特币核心钱包数据库的架构 ### 1. 数据库的基本概念 比特币核心钱包的数据库是一个用于存储用户钱包相关数据的系统,包括地址、余额、交易历史等信息。其数据结构是以区块链为基础,采用了去中心化的设计,使得每一笔交易及其相关信息都可以被追踪和验证。核心钱包通常使用SQLite作为数据库管理系统,这是一种轻量级的关系型数据库,适合用于个人计算机和移动设备。 ### 2. 关键的数据表 比特币核心钱包的数据库主要由几个关键数据表组成: - **地址表**:存储用户生成的每一个比特币地址及其相关信息。 - **交易表**:记录所有的比特币交易信息,包括交易ID、金额、时间戳等。 - **区块表**:包含区块链中每个区块的信息,用于验证交易的合法性。 - **锁定表**:针对尚未确认的交易或地址的使用进行锁定,以防止双重支付。 ### 3. 数据的存储方式 比特币核心钱包数据库中的数据采用的是树形结构,特别是使用了Merkle树来组织交易信息。这一结构的优势在于能够快速验证某项交易是否在区块中,且在数据量巨大的情况下,依然可以保持良好的查询效率。 ## 二、数据库的功能与特性 ### 1. 可靠性 比特币核心钱包的数据库设计注重数据的完整性和一致性。每一笔交易在被添加到数据库之前,都会经过严密的验证流程,从而确保数据的可靠性。 ### 2. 安全性 为防止数据被篡改,比特币核心钱包的数据库会定期进行备份,并对敏感信息进行加密处理。此外,用户的私钥会被安全地存储在数据库中,确保只有拥有正确密码的用户才能访问。 ### 3. 易用性 即使是技术小白,也能通过比特币核心钱包的友好界面轻松管理自己的比特币资产。透过图形化的界面,用户可以直观地查看余额、交易记录,并进行相应操作。 ### 4. 扩展性 随着比特币全民普及,用户日益增长,核心钱包数据库也在不断进行和扩展,以适应不断变化的市场需求。这种灵活性让用户在未来能够享受更加卓越的使用体验。 ## 三、神级更新带来的变革 ### 1. 性能提升 近期的神级更新主要集中在提升数据库的性能上,通过查询算法、减少数据冗余等手段,大幅提高了交易处理速度,使得用户在高峰期也能顺畅使用钱包。 ### 2. 新增功能 新的更新增加了多种新功能,例如对用户交易行为的智能建议功能,能够基于过去的数据预测用户的交易需求。此外,二次交易验证功能也增强了安全措施。 ### 3. 用户交互提升 更新还引入了一些用户交互的新设计,使得钱包界面更加友好,操作过程更加流畅。用户可以通过简单的操作完成复杂的交易,提高了整体用户满意度。 ## 四、常见问题解答 ###

比特币核心钱包如何保证数据的安全性?

比特币核心钱包在数据安全性方面采取了多重措施。首先,数据库内的数据存储方式被设计为去中心化,避免单点故障。同时,敏感信息如私钥会进行加密存储,并通过多层验证机制确保只有特定的用户能够访问。同时,钱包也提供实时备份功能,让用户即使在数据丢失或损坏的情况下,也能够及时恢复其资产。

此外,为了防止恶意软件的攻击,用户可以选择启用多重签名功能,增加交易的安全性。即使攻击者获取了用户的一部分信息,也需要额外的私钥才能进行交易,这有效降低了资产被盗风险。

###

如何选择合适的比特币核心钱包版本?

在选择比特币核心钱包的版本时,用户应考虑几个关键因素。首先是用户操作系统的兼容性,不同版本涉及不同的操作系统,如Windows、macOS和Linux等,因此用户需要根据自己计算机的系统类型来选择合适的版本。

其次是功能需求,不同版本的钱包可能会对特定功能有不同的支持。用户需要仔细阅读每个版本的更新日志,了解新功能和修复项,选择一个最适合自己需求的版本。此外,建议用户选用最新版本,以避免因安全漏洞或过期的功能而影响资产的安全性。

最后,用户可以参考其他用户的反馈和评论,这些真实的使用经验会帮助用户更好地决定。在使用概率较高的情况下,用户也可进行实际体验,通过比较各个版本,选择自己最为熟悉和安全的一个。

###

比特币核心钱包如何与区块链进行交互?

比特币核心钱包通过使用节点与区块链网络进行交互。每当用户创建交易时,钱包会将交易信息发送至最近的节点,然后由节点将交易打包到新区块,并将其添加到区块链上。用户的本地数据库也会随着区块链的更新而及时更新,确保数据一致性。

同时,比特币核心钱包也运行着一个完整的比特币节点,能够实时接收和发送交易数据,同步最新区块链信息。通过这种方式,用户可以实现信息的实时返回,获得准确的余额和交易历史。

此外,钱包还会定期与其他节点进行数据同步,以确保即使在网络波动或节点离线的情况下,用户依然可以顺利完成交易和资产管理。这种设计增强了比特币核心钱包的可靠性和可用性,使其成为用户的理想选择。

###

比特币核心钱包的备份和恢复流程是怎样的?

备份和恢复比特币核心钱包是确保用户资产安全的重要措施。用户可以通过钱包软件的设置选项选择“备份钱包”,系统会生成一个包含用户所有私钥和账户信息的文件。用户可以将此文件安全地存储在外部硬盘或云存储中,以避免因计算机故障而丢失数字资产。

在需要恢复钱包时,用户只需删除现有钱包数据,重新安装比特币核心钱包软件,然后选择“恢复钱包”,并导入之前备份的文件。此过程会将用户的所有地址和余额信息恢复到钱包中,确保用户不丢失任何资产。

值得注意的是,用户还可以选择手动导出私钥,并将其保存在安全的位置。在恢复时,只需将私钥导入新钱包中,便可完成资产的恢复。这些措施确保了即便在恶劣情况下,用户的比特币资产也能得到安全保障。

###

比特币核心钱包适合哪些用户?

比特币核心钱包适合多种类型的用户,尤其是那些重视安全和隐私的用户。由于其去中心化的特性和高水平的安全机制,核心钱包为高级用户、投资者、矿工以及任何需要长期存储比特币的用户提供了良好的选择。

此外,技术爱好者和开发者也能充分发挥比特币核心钱包的优势。它为用户提供了强大的功能和灵活的设计,允许用户根据需要进行高级配置和自定义设置。在功能丰富的同时,核心钱包也为那些希望深入理解比特币机制和运行机制的用户提供了必要的工具和信息。

不过,对于新手用户或不想承担复杂操作的普通用户来说,可能会觉得比特币核心钱包的使用门槛较高。此时,使用其他更为简化的网络钱包或手机钱包可能是更好的选择。不过,随着钱包界面的与用户引导的强化,许多普通用户也逐渐转向使用核心钱包来管理其比特币资产,这无疑是比特币发展过程中的一种积极趋势。

## 结语 比特币核心钱包的数据库及其相关功能正在随着技术的发展持续演变。无论是安全性、性能,还是用户体验,随着黑科技的不断应用和神级更新的推出,比特币核心钱包正朝着更加智能化、便利化的方向发展。了解这些变化,不仅能够帮助用户更好地管理自己的数字资产,还能够提升他们对比特币及其他数字货币的认知。在未来的数字金融时代,比特币核心钱包无疑将继续扮演着重要的角色。